# EKS & ALB Optimization Guide for Error Reduction
## Infrastructure Overview
This project uses AWS EKS with Application Load Balancer (ALB) for the Formbricks application. The infrastructure has been optimized to minimize ELB 502/504 errors through careful configuration of connection handling, health checks, and pod lifecycle management.
## Key Infrastructure Files
### Terraform Configuration
- **Main Infrastructure**: [infra/terraform/main.tf](mdc:infra/terraform/main.tf) - EKS cluster, VPC, Karpenter, and core AWS resources
- **Monitoring**: [infra/terraform/cloudwatch.tf](mdc:infra/terraform/cloudwatch.tf) - CloudWatch alarms for 502/504 error tracking and alerting
- **Database**: [infra/terraform/rds.tf](mdc:infra/terraform/rds.tf) - Aurora PostgreSQL configuration
### Helm Configuration
- **Production**: [inf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/values.yaml.gotmpl](mdc:inf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/values.yaml.gotmpl) - Optimized ALB and pod configurations
- **Staging**: [inf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/values-staging.yaml.gotmpl](mdc:inf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/values-staging.yaml.gotmpl) - Staging environment with spot instances
- **Deployment**: [inf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/helmfile.yaml.gotmpl](mdc:infra/formbricks-cloud-helm/helmfile.yaml.gotmpl) - Multi-environment Helm releases
## ALB Optimization Patterns
### Connection Handling Optimizations
```yaml
# Key ALB annotations for reducing 502/504 errors
alb.ingress.kubernetes.io/load-balancer-attributes: |
idle_timeout.timeout_seconds=120,
connection_logs.s3.enabled=false,
access_logs.s3.enabled=false
alb.ingress.kubernetes.io/target-group-attributes: |
deregistration_delay.timeout_seconds=30,
stickiness.enabled=false,
load_balancing.algorithm.type=least_outstanding_requests,
target_group_health.dns_failover.minimum_healthy_targets.count=1
```
### Health Check Configuration
- **Interval**: 15 seconds for faster detection of unhealthy targets
- **Timeout**: 5 seconds to prevent false positives
- **Thresholds**: 2 healthy, 3 unhealthy for balanced responsiveness
- **Path**: `/health` endpoint optimized for < 100ms response time
## Pod Lifecycle Management
### Graceful Shutdown Pattern
```yaml
# PreStop hook to allow connection draining
lifecycle:
preStop:
exec:
command: ["/bin/sh", "-c", "sleep 15"]
# Termination grace period for complete cleanup
terminationGracePeriodSeconds: 45
```
### Health Probe Strategy
- **Startup Probe**: 5s initial delay, 5s interval, max 60s startup time
- **Readiness Probe**: 10s delay, 10s interval for traffic readiness
- **Liveness Probe**: 30s delay, 30s interval for container health
### Rolling Update Configuration
```yaml
strategy:
type: RollingUpdate
rollingUpdate:
maxUnavailable: 25% # Maintain capacity during updates
maxSurge: 50% # Allow faster rollouts
```
## Karpenter Node Management
### Node Lifecycle Optimization
- **Startup Taints**: Prevent traffic during node initialization
- **Graceful Shutdown**: 30s grace period for pod eviction
- **Consolidation Delay**: 60s to reduce unnecessary churn
- **Eviction Policies**: Configured for smooth pod migrations
### Instance Selection
- **Families**: c8g, c7g, m8g, m7g, r8g, r7g (ARM64 Graviton)
- **Sizes**: 2, 4, 8 vCPUs for cost optimization
- **Bottlerocket AMI**: Enhanced security and performance
## Monitoring & Alerting
### Critical ALB Metrics
1. **ELB 502 Errors**: Threshold 20 over 5 minutes
2. **ELB 504 Errors**: Threshold 15 over 5 minutes
3. **Target Connection Errors**: Threshold 50 over 5 minutes
4. **4XX Errors**: Threshold 100 over 10 minutes (client issues)
### Expected Improvements
- **60-80% reduction** in ELB 502 errors
- **Faster recovery** during pod restarts
- **Better connection reuse** efficiency
- **Improved autoscaling** responsiveness
## Deployment Patterns
### Infrastructure Updates
1. **Terraform First**: Apply infrastructure changes via [infra/deploy-improvements.sh](mdc:infra/deploy-improvements.sh)
2. **Helm Second**: Deploy application configurations
3. **Verification**: Check pod status, endpoints, and ALB health
4. **Monitoring**: Watch CloudWatch metrics for 24-48 hours
### Environment-Specific Configurations
- **Production**: On-demand instances, stricter resource limits
- **Staging**: Spot instances, rate limiting disabled, relaxed resources
## Troubleshooting Patterns
### 502 Error Investigation
1. Check pod readiness and health probe status
2. Verify ALB target group health
3. Review deregistration timing during deployments
4. Monitor connection pool utilization
### 504 Error Analysis
1. Check application response times
2. Verify timeout configurations (ALB: 120s, App: aligned)
3. Review database query performance
4. Monitor resource utilization during traffic spikes
### Connection Error Patterns
1. Verify Karpenter node lifecycle timing
2. Check pod termination grace periods
3. Review ALB connection draining settings
4. Monitor cluster autoscaling events
## Best Practices
### When Making Changes
- **Test in staging first** with same configurations
- **Monitor metrics** for 24-48 hours after changes
- **Use gradual rollouts** with proper health checks
- **Maintain ALB timeout alignment** across all layers
### Performance Optimization
- **Health endpoint** should respond < 100ms consistently
- **Connection pooling** aligned with ALB idle timeouts
- **Resource requests/limits** tuned for consistent performance
- **Graceful shutdown** implemented in application code
### Monitoring Strategy
- **Real-time alerts** for error rate spikes
- **Trend analysis** for connection patterns
- **Capacity planning** based on LCU usage
- **4XX pattern analysis** for client behavior insights

# Review & Refine
Before finalizing any code changes, review your implementation against these quality standards:
## Core Principles
### DRY (Don't Repeat Yourself)
- Extract duplicated logic into reusable functions or hooks
- If the same code appears in multiple places, consolidate it
- Create helper functions at appropriate scope (component-level, module-level, or utility files)
- Avoid copy-pasting code blocks
### Code Reduction
- Remove unnecessary code, comments, and abstractions
- Prefer built-in solutions over custom implementations
- Consolidate similar logic
- Remove dead code and unused imports
- Question if every line of code is truly needed
## React Best Practices
### Component Design
- Keep components focused on a single responsibility
- Extract complex logic into custom hooks
- Prefer composition over prop drilling
- Use children props and render props when appropriate
- Keep component files under 300 lines when possible
### Hooks Usage
- Follow Rules of Hooks (only call at top level, only in React functions)
- Extract complex `useEffect` logic into custom hooks
- Use `useMemo` and `useCallback` only when you have a measured performance issue
- Declare dependencies arrays correctly - don't ignore exhaustive-deps warnings
- Keep `useEffect` focused on a single concern
### State Management
- Colocate state as close as possible to where it's used
- Lift state only when necessary
- Use `useReducer` for complex state logic with multiple sub-values
- Avoid derived state - compute values during render instead
- Don't store values in state that can be computed from props
### Event Handlers
- Name event handlers with `handle` prefix (e.g., `handleClick`, `handleSubmit`)
- Extract complex event handler logic into separate functions
- Avoid inline arrow functions in JSX when they contain complex logic
## TypeScript Best Practices
### Type Safety
- Prefer type inference over explicit types when possible
- Use `const` assertions for literal types
- Avoid `any` - use `unknown` if type is truly unknown
- Use discriminated unions for complex conditional logic
- Leverage type guards and narrowing
### Interface & Type Usage
- Use existing types from `@formbricks/types` - don't recreate them
- Prefer `interface` for object shapes that might be extended
- Prefer `type` for unions, intersections, and mapped types
- Define types close to where they're used unless they're shared
- Export types from index files for shared types
### Type Assertions
- Avoid type assertions (`as`) when possible
- Use type guards instead of assertions
- Only assert when you have more information than TypeScript
## Code Organization
### Separation of Concerns
- Separate business logic from UI rendering
- Extract API calls into separate functions or modules
- Keep data transformation separate from component logic
- Use custom hooks for stateful logic that doesn't render UI
### Function Clarity
- Functions should do one thing well
- Name functions clearly and descriptively
- Keep functions small (aim for under 20 lines)
- Extract complex conditionals into named boolean variables or functions
- Avoid deep nesting (max 3 levels)
### File Structure
- Group related functions together
- Order declarations logically (types → hooks → helpers → component)
- Keep imports organized (external → internal → relative)
- Consider splitting large files by concern
## Additional Quality Checks
### Performance
- Don't optimize prematurely - measure first
- Avoid creating new objects/arrays/functions in render unnecessarily
- Use keys properly in lists (stable, unique identifiers)
- Lazy load heavy components when appropriate
### Accessibility
- Use semantic HTML elements
- Include ARIA labels where needed
- Ensure keyboard navigation works
- Check color contrast and focus states
### Error Handling
- Handle error states in components
- Provide user feedback for failed operations
- Use error boundaries for component errors
- Log errors appropriately (avoid swallowing errors silently)
### Naming Conventions
- Use descriptive names (avoid abbreviations unless very common)
- Boolean variables/props should sound like yes/no questions (`isLoading`, `hasError`, `canEdit`)
- Arrays should be plural (`users`, `choices`, `items`)
- Event handlers: `handleX` in components, `onX` for props
- Constants in UPPER_SNAKE_CASE only for true constants
### Code Readability
- Prefer early returns to reduce nesting
- Use destructuring to make code clearer
- Break complex expressions into named variables
- Add comments only when code can't be made self-explanatory
- Use whitespace to group related code
### Testing Considerations
- Write code that's easy to test (pure functions, clear inputs/outputs)
- Avoid hard-to-mock dependencies when possible
- Keep side effects at the edges of your code
## Review Checklist
Before submitting your changes, ask yourself:
1. **DRY**: Is there any duplicated logic I can extract?
2. **Clarity**: Would another developer understand this code easily?
3. **Simplicity**: Is this the simplest solution that works?
4. **Types**: Am I using TypeScript effectively?
5. **React**: Am I following React idioms and best practices?
6. **Performance**: Are there obvious performance issues?
7. **Separation**: Are concerns properly separated?
8. **Testing**: Is this code testable?
9. **Maintenance**: Will this be easy to change in 6 months?
10. **Deletion**: Can I remove any code and still accomplish the goal?
## When to Apply This Rule
Apply this rule:
- After implementing a feature but before marking it complete
- When you notice your code feels "messy" or complex
- Before requesting code review
- When you see yourself copy-pasting code
- After receiving feedback about code quality
Don't let perfect be the enemy of good, but always strive for:
**Simple, readable, maintainable code that does one thing well.**

# Repository Guidelines
## Project Structure & Module Organization
Formbricks runs as a pnpm/turbo monorepo. `apps/web` is the Next.js product surface, with feature modules under `app/` and `modules/`, assets in `public/` and `images/`, and Playwright specs in `apps/web/playwright/`. `apps/storybook` renders reusable UI pieces for review. Shared logic lives in `packages/*`: `database` (Prisma schemas/migrations), `surveys`, `js-core`, `types`, plus linting and TypeScript presets (`config-*`). Deployment collateral is kept in `docs/`, `docker/`, and `helm-chart/`. Tests generally sit next to their source as `*.test.ts(x)` or inside `__tests__`.
## Build, Test & Development Commands
- `pnpm install` — install workspace dependencies pinned by `pnpm-lock.yaml`.
- `pnpm db:up` / `pnpm db:down` — start/stop the Docker services backing the app.
- `pnpm dev` — run all app and worker dev servers in parallel via Turborepo.
- `pnpm build` — generate production builds for every package and app.
- `pnpm lint` — apply the shared ESLint rules across the workspace.
- `pnpm test` / `pnpm test:coverage` — execute Vitest suites with optional coverage.
- `pnpm test:e2e` — launch the Playwright browser regression suite.
- `pnpm db:migrate:dev` — apply Prisma migrations against the dev database.
## Coding Style & Naming Conventions
TypeScript, React, and Prisma are the primary languages. Use the shared ESLint presets (`@formbricks/eslint-config`) and Prettier preset (110-char width, semicolons, double quotes, sorted import groups). Two-space indentation is standard; prefer `PascalCase` for React components and folders under `modules/`, `camelCase` for functions/variables, and `SCREAMING_SNAKE_CASE` only for constants. When adding mocks, place them inside `__mocks__` so import ordering stays stable.
## Testing Guidelines
Prefer Vitest with Testing Library for logic in `.ts` files, keeping specs colocated with the code they exercise (`utility.test.ts`). Do not write tests for `.tsx` files. Mock network and storage boundaries through helpers from `@formbricks/*`. Run `pnpm test` before opening a PR and `pnpm test:coverage` when touching critical flows; keep coverage from regressing. End-to-end scenarios belong in `apps/web/playwright`, using descriptive filenames (`billing.spec.ts`) and tagging slow suites with `@slow` when necessary.
## Commit & Pull Request Guidelines
Commits follow a lightweight Conventional Commit format (`fix:`, `chore:`, `feat:`) and usually append the PR number, e.g. `fix: update OpenAPI schema (#6617)`. Keep commits scoped and lint-clean. Pull requests should outline the problem, summarize the solution, and link to issues or product specs. Attach screenshots or gifs for UI-facing work, list any migrations or env changes, and paste the output of relevant commands (`pnpm test`, `pnpm lint`, `pnpm db:migrate:dev`) so reviewers can verify readiness.
